1. By filing this writ petition, the petitioner has prayed for the following reliefs:-
“for issuance of appropriate writ’s, order/s, direction/s for direction upon the respondents to pay benefit of 1st, 2nd & 3rd A.C.P./M.A.C.P. and also grant promotional benefits to the post of Assistant Settlement Officer/Circle Officer in view of Notification issued by Personnel, Administrative Reforms and Rajbhasha Department and revise the pension after giving benefit of A.C.P./M.A.C.P. and promotional benefits with statutory interest.
